HC Deb 31 January 2001 vol 362 c216W
Mr. Chope

To ask the Secretary of State for Health what action the Government are taking in response to the views of the beta interferon appeal panel on selecting patients for treatment with beta interferon. [147036]

Mr. Denham

The panel was set up to examine specific procedural points relating to the determination of the Appraisal Committee on beta interferon. The National Institute for Clinical Excellence (NICE) asked the Appraisal Committee to reconsider the matters in the light of the appeal panel's decision.

NICE has now extended the timescale for its appraisal of both beta interferon and glatiramer acetate to enable further research to be undertaken on their cost effectiveness. NICE will review the outcome of the new modelling in the summer and unless there are further appeals would expect to issue its guidance by this November.
